数据库 独占什么意思

fiy 其他 4

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库独占是指在某一时刻,只有一个用户或一个应用程序能够访问和使用数据库的一部分或全部资源。在数据库独占的情况下,其他用户或应用程序无法同时访问数据库,直到独占的用户或应用程序释放了数据库资源。

    以下是数据库独占的几个重要方面:

    1. 数据库连接:在数据库独占的情况下,只有一个用户或应用程序能够建立与数据库的连接。其他用户或应用程序无法同时建立连接,必须等待独占用户或应用程序释放连接。

    2. 数据库操作:独占用户或应用程序可以执行各种数据库操作,包括读取、写入、更新和删除数据等。其他用户或应用程序无法同时执行这些操作,只能等待独占用户或应用程序完成操作后才能进行。

    3. 数据一致性:数据库独占可以确保数据的一致性。在独占的情况下,只有一个用户或应用程序对数据进行操作,不会发生数据冲突或数据不一致的情况。

    4. 资源利用率:数据库独占可以提高资源的利用率。由于只有一个用户或应用程序在使用数据库,其他用户或应用程序无法访问数据库,可以避免资源的浪费。

    5. 数据安全性:数据库独占可以提高数据的安全性。只有一个用户或应用程序可以访问和修改数据库,可以更好地控制数据的访问权限,减少数据泄露和不当操作的风险。

    总而言之,数据库独占是指在某一时刻,只有一个用户或一个应用程序能够访问和使用数据库的一部分或全部资源。它可以提高数据的一致性、资源的利用率和数据的安全性,但也可能导致其他用户或应用程序的等待时间增加。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库的独占指的是在某个时间段内,只允许一个用户或进程对数据库进行访问和操作。在独占模式下,其他用户或进程无法同时访问该数据库,直到当前用户或进程释放对数据库的独占权限。

    独占模式通常用于某些特定的操作,例如数据库的备份、恢复、维护等。在进行这些操作时,需要确保数据库不会被其他用户或进程干扰或修改。

    当数据库处于独占模式时,其他用户或进程在尝试访问数据库时会被阻塞或等待,直到独占模式结束。这可以确保数据库的一致性和数据的完整性。

    值得注意的是,数据库的独占模式并不适用于所有情况。在大多数情况下,数据库是以共享模式运行,允许多个用户或进程同时访问和操作数据库。只有在必要的情况下才会使用独占模式,以确保对数据库的特定操作的安全性和准确性。

    总之,数据库的独占模式指的是在某个时间段内,只允许一个用户或进程对数据库进行访问和操作,以确保对数据库的特定操作的安全性和准确性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库的独占指的是在某个时间段内,一个用户或一个进程独自占用整个数据库的使用权限,其他用户或进程无法同时访问或修改该数据库。这种独占状态可以保证数据的一致性和完整性,防止并发操作导致的数据冲突和混乱。

    数据库的独占可以分为两种情况:独占读和独占写。

    1. 独占读:一个用户或一个进程独占数据库的读取权限,其他用户或进程无法同时读取该数据库。这种情况通常发生在需要进行大量数据分析或复杂查询的情况下,为了保证查询结果的准确性,需要独占读取数据库。

    2. 独占写:一个用户或一个进程独占数据库的写入权限,其他用户或进程无法同时修改该数据库。这种情况通常发生在需要进行数据更新、删除或插入操作的情况下,为了保证数据的一致性和完整性,需要独占写入数据库。

    实现数据库的独占需要使用锁机制来控制对数据库的访问。常用的锁机制包括共享锁和排他锁。

    1. 共享锁:多个用户或进程可以同时获得共享锁,允许读取数据库,但不允许修改数据库。共享锁可以保证多个用户同时读取数据库时数据的一致性,但不保证写操作的一致性。

    2. 排他锁:只有一个用户或进程可以获得排他锁,允许读取和修改数据库。排他锁可以保证在修改数据库时数据的一致性,但不允许其他用户同时访问数据库。

    在实际应用中,数据库的独占往往是根据业务需求和系统性能进行调整的。如果数据库的并发访问较高,可以采用较短的独占时间或使用较轻量级的锁机制,以提高系统的并发性能。反之,如果数据库的一致性要求较高,可以采用较长的独占时间或使用较重量级的锁机制,以保证数据的完整性和一致性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部